Financial Performance Overview
Adani Ports' Q3 results were marked by robust financial performance. The company's consolidated profit witnessed a notable increase, rising by 16% to reach
Rs 2,208 crore. This significant growth underscores the company's ability to navigate economic challenges and capitalize on market opportunities. The figures reflect strategic decisions and operational efficiencies within Adani Ports. This strong performance could potentially lead to increased investor confidence and further expansion plans, thus solidifying its position within India's port sector. The rise in profits also points to improved operational efficiency, which includes streamlined logistics and enhanced port operations, contributing to better margins and overall financial health.
